2. The genre of my magazine is punk-rock and so it represents the same
social group. To meet the standards of this group, I have included
bands and artists that create music of the punk-rock genre. These
include all of the artists on the front cover and contents page. The
model in my dominant images represents this social group well as she
is in their age group, which is typically teenagers and young adults. She
also has blue hair and a facial piercing, which further represents the
stereotypes of the punk-rock genre and its social standards. Another
stereotype of this particular social group is that they are believed to be
particularly pessimistic, often described as moody. In an attempt to
portray this, my model is looking away from he camera and wearing
dark clothing. The costume choice further represents this social group
as they are stereotypically portrayed wearing dark colours, which often
contrast with brightly coloured hair.
